How they compare

Latvia currently reports 0.7244 Mt CO2e against 0.701 Mt CO2e in Mali, a difference of 0.0234 Mt CO2e.

Across all 55 years both countries report, Latvia has been ahead every year.

Latvia ranks 112th and Mali ranks 114th of 203 countries.

Latvia has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.

A measure of annual emissions of carbon dioxide (CO2), one of the six Kyoto greenhouse gases (GHG), from industrial processes including IPCC 2006 codes 2.A.1 Cement production, 2.A.2 Lime production, 2.A.3 Glass Production, 2.A.4 Other Process Uses of Carbonates, 2.B Chemical Industry, 2.C Metal Industry, 2.D Non-Energy Products from Fuels and Solvent Use, 2.E Electronics Industry, 2.F Product Uses as Substitutes for Ozone Depleting Substances, 2.G Other Product Manufacture and Use and 5.A Indirect N2O emissions from the atmospheric deposition of nitrogen in NOx and NH3. The measure is standardized to carbon dioxide equivalent values using the Global Warming Potential (GWP) factors of IPCC's 5th Assessment Report (AR5).
